1. How much work is done by a person if he lifts a load of 500 kg upto a height of 2m?​

Respuesta :

jamyangnorzin
jamyangnorzin jamyangnorzin
  • 01-01-2021

Explanation:

if we take g=9.8m/s^2

F=mg

m=500

F=500×9.8=4900N

h=2

so w=mgh

w=4900×2

=9800j
